The Coming of the King is a novel written by Bernie Babcock and published in 1921. The book is set in a fictional kingdom called Averna, which is on the brink of war with its neighboring country. The story follows the journey of a young prince named Prince Karl, who is forced to take the throne after his father's sudden death. As Prince Karl takes on his new role as king, he faces numerous challenges and obstacles. He must navigate the treacherous political landscape of Averna, dealing with corrupt officials and ambitious nobles who seek to take advantage of the kingdom's instability. Meanwhile, he must also contend with the looming threat of war, as the neighboring country prepares to invade.Throughout the book, Prince Karl learns valuable lessons about leadership, courage, and sacrifice. He forms alliances with unlikely allies and makes difficult decisions that test his character and his commitment to his people. The Coming of the King is a classic tale of political intrigue, war, and heroism.
